    6 L L u u b b r r i i c c a a n n t t s s 1. Ikelite provides silicone lubricant with the housing. We recommend you use only Ikelite lubricant on Ikelite products as some other brands may cause the o'ring to swell and not seal properly. 2. Use only enough lubricant to lightly cover control shafts and o'rings. Wipe off any excess lubricant[...]
